Magnesium Oxide Product Overview

Magnesium oxide (chemical formula MgO) is a high-melting-point, non-toxic, white powdered inorganic compound. As an alkaline oxide, it possesses excellent fire resistance, chemical stability, and adsorption properties. It is widely used in industrial refractory materials, pharmaceutical antacids, environmental pollution control, food additives, and new energy materials.

Characteristics of Magnesium Oxide

Magnesium oxide used in glass fiber production must possess specific characteristics that are compatible with the glass melting process and fiber performance requirements:

  • High purity and low impurities: Typically, the magnesium oxide content is required to be ≥95%, with strict control of impurities such as silicon, iron, calcium, and chlorine (e.g., iron ≤ 0.1%, calcium ≤ 0.5%). This prevents impurities from forming bubbles or stones in the molten glass, ensuring defect-free finished glass fibers.
  • Appropriate activity and particle size: Magnesium oxide powders with medium-to-low activity (activity value 40-60s) and fine particle size (average particle size 1-5μm) allow for uniform mixing with glass raw materials and rapid dissolution during high-temperature melting.
  • Stable chemical properties: The powder must be heat-resistant (above 2800°C) with non-decomposition and non-volatilization in glass melting environments (1500-1600°C). It must stably react with elements such as silicon and aluminum to form a dense glass structure.
  • Low hygroscopicity and good fluidity: The finished product must be dried to a moisture content of ≤0.5% to prevent moisture absorption and agglomeration. The powder must exhibit good fluidity for continuous feeding and precise metering requirements.
Advantages of Magnesium Oxide

Magnesium oxide plays a key functional role in glass fiber production with multiple advantages:

  • Performance enhancement: Improves high-temperature resistance, tensile strength, impact resistance, and corrosion resistance of glass fibers.
  • Production optimization: Reduces glass melt viscosity, improves fluidity, and facilitates smooth drawing and forming processes.
  • Cost-effective: Wide availability of raw materials and low cost while maintaining performance standards.
  • Environmental benefits: Non-toxic and non-volatile properties meet green production requirements.
  • Composite material improvement: Enhances interfacial bonding in glass fiber reinforced composites, improving structural stability and mechanical properties.
